
Proverbs 5:18-19 says "Let thy fountain be blessed and rejoice with the wife of thy youth. Let her be as the loving hind and pleasant roe; let her breasts satisfy thee at all times, and be thou ravished always with her love."
To be ravished is to be filled with delight. The best way to describe that feeling is when you fall backwards onto your bed with just shear pleasure. What a gift the LORD gives to humans is the pure pleasure that comes not from sex, but from love.
The world teaches that sex is as natural as food. The problem is that there is no spiritual connection with food. God told Adam to take his wife and be one flesh. He couldn't have been talking about the physical connection, but the spiritual connection.
I pray that all of you may be ravished with the love of your spouse.
For those tempted to pleasure apart from marriage, I can tell you the wait is worth the while.
